Atraric acid is a naturally occurring phenolic compound and ester with the IUPAC name methyl 2,4-dihydroxy-3,6-dimethylbenzoate and molecular formula C10H12O4.
[2] It occurs in the root-bark of Pygeum africanum[3] and Evernia prunastri (Oakmoss).
There is evidence to suggest that it has antiandrogenic activity in humans[3] and its use in treatment of benign prostate hyperplasia, prostate cancer, and spinal and bulbar muscular atrophy has been investigated.
